Goal of the course: At the end of the course, students will have a fair understanding of some standard concepts in concurrent programming (programming and reasoning). The students will be exposed to multiple models of concurrency (and parallel programming languages).
Assignment | What? | Credit | Start date | Due-date |
P1 | Java assignment | 4% | 20 Jan 2018 | 02 Feb 2018, 11:59PM |
P2 | Java assignment | 4% | 21 Feb 2018 | 02 Mar 2018, 11:59PM |
P3 | OpenMP assignment | 8% | 03 Mar 2018 | 11 Mar 2018, 11:59PM |
P4 | OpenMP assignment | 8% | 14 Mar 2018, | 25 Mar 2018, 11:59PM |
P5 | MPI assignment | 8% | 31 Mar 2018, | 13 Apr 2018, 11:59PM |
P6 | OpenMP + MPI assignment | 8% | 14 Apr 2018 | 28 Apr 2018, 11:59PM |
Written Exams: